gcc/
        * config/riscv/elf.h (LINK_SPEC): Pass linker endianness flag.
        * config/riscv/freebsd.h (LINK_SPEC): Likewise.
        * config/riscv/linux.h (LINK_SPEC): Likewise.
        * config/riscv/riscv.h (ASM_SPEC): Pass -mbig-endian and
        -mlittle-endian.
        (BYTES_BIG_ENDIAN): Handle big endian.
        (WORDS_BIG_ENDIAN): Define to BYTES_BIG_ENDIAN.
        * config/riscv/riscv.opt (-mbig-endian, -mlittle-endian): New
        options.
        * doc/invoke.texi (-mbig-endian, -mlittle-endian): Document.

+@item -mbig-endian
+@opindex mbig-endian
+Generate big-endian code.  This is the default when GCC is configured for a
+@samp{riscv64be-*-*} or @samp{riscv32be-*-*} target.
+
+@item -mlittle-endian
+@opindex mlittle-endian
+Generate little-endian code.  This is the default when GCC is configured for a
+@samp{riscv64-*-*} or @samp{riscv32-*-*} but not a @samp{riscv64be-*-*} or
+@samp{riscv32be-*-*} target.
